Chili Ginger Garlic Beans (Majestic Beans) with Whipped Cumin Tofu and Onion Salad

High protein, bold chili ginger garlic beans with cumin tofu and spicy onion salad. 30 minutes recipe, serve on toast, fries, baked potatoes, in smashed tacos, wraps or bowl. nut-free and gluten-free, 22 grams protein and 10 grams of fiber)

When weeknight dinners feel a little same-old, these chili ginger garlic beans are about to wake things up. They’re saucy, punchy, and layered with heat, balanced by creamy cumin-lime whipped tofu and a quick spicy onion salad. It’s bold, high-protein, and done in about 30 minutes.

Pile them on toast, tuck it into a baked potato, a dip platter, over roasted veg, in a wrap or go full comfort mode over crispy fries. One recipe, many moods. I prepped these and my garlic vinegar chickpeas and serve them in so many ways – watch on my YouTube channel !

We are reimagining Indian food today with beans majestic, a plant-based spin on chicken majestic. If you want a more traditional vegan version of Indian chicken majestic, check out my tofu majestic recipe. It’s super easy and full of flavor!

When people think of Indian food, they tend to think of Indian curries. But Indian cuisine that goes so far beyond curries and other saucy dishes served with flatbread and rice. There are so many creative ways that you can serve classic Indian dishes!

These saucy, chili garlic curry leaf beans are basically taking the sauce inspired from my tofu majestic, simplifying it, and adding beans to it. And it works so beautifully! It’s saucy, spicy, delicious, and pairs really well with lots of different components.

We make the beans along with a creamy, whipped tofu and pair these with a quick onion ring salad. Then, we’re going to pair these components in lots of different ways: on toast, as a dip, over baked potatoes or crispy potatoes(chili cheese fries style), or as crispy tacos!

Why You’ll Love Chili Garlic Beans

  • 1-pan white beans packed with amazing Indian flavors
  • creamy, curry-inspired, blender tofu whip takes only minutes to make
  • quick pickled onion salad adds tang and crunch
  • versatile! 1 dish can be served 4 or more ways
  • naturally nut-free with easy gluten-free option

Easy Lentil Dip with Crispy Capers

Flavor-packed lentil dip comes together fast with serious protein and fiber punch! Lentils, roasted corn, veggies and crispy capers with herby pepper lime dressing is perfect for parties, potlucks, cookouts, and snacking! (gluten-free, soy-free, nut-free) High fiber, protein and iron!

This is the perfect lentil dip for summer. I was inspired by a lentil dip that went viral on TikTok, where you just take some lentils, add bruschetta and feta, Instead of those flavors, we’re adding a load of veggies and a fantastic dressing, and also crisp capers! All these flavors and textures have made this my fave this summer!

This lentil dip is a great source of protein, fiber, vitamin C, B vitamins, potassium, magnesium, and iron and omegas. Protein from the lentils hemp seeds nutritional yeast, fiber from the veggies, lentils, kale. Major flavor boost from the Crispy capers! This indulgent Lentil dip packs a flavor and nutrition punch!

There’s the protein from the lentils. There are the fresh, crunchy veggies, jalapeΓ±o, and onion. There’s sweetness from the corn and the apple, the tart freshness from the cherry tomatoes, and refreshing vibrancy from the lime zest.Β 
There’s also kale in the dip, hidden along with some herbs, so it’s a great way to sneak in kale.

The nutritional yeast adds a bit of cheesiness and protein, while the hemp seeds bump up the protein and texture even more. And all of that balances out with a hint of spice from the jalapeΓ±o and the pepper flakes and a savory burst of flavor from the crispy capers.

You can use whichever veggies you have on hand. If you don’t like lentils, you can use chickpeas or white beans and add some more spices to the dressing.Β 

Make this dip and serve it with tortilla chips, crispy crackers, garlic bread or baguette slices. You can also use it to make wraps with pita bread or tortillas. It’s a versatile lentil dip that will disappear in no time.Β

Why You’ll Love this Lentil Dip

  • protein- and veggie-packed dip with amazing flavors and textures
  • quick and easy herb-lime dressing comes together in 1 jar
  • crispy capers add a little crunch and a ton of umami
  • naturally gluten-free, soy-free, and nut-free
